Orilissa has definitely stopped the pain. I was on the two a day regimen which you can only be on for the 6 months.so my doctor started me on that and then after 2 months I went down to the one a day so that I ca use it for 2 years. And there is still no pain, I do have the occasional cramps feeling which is managed with an aleve. It can cause bone damage and I’ve had some hip issues and my hot flashes are terrible. But my cycle has completely stopped which is the root of the endo problem. I do also have in a Mirena which I thought was making things worse and it didn’t stop my period as I’d hoped. The combo seems to work now but I’m still kinda want the Mirena out, but of course my doc thinks I should keep it in. Hope this helps.
